Parents and other adults are invited to a conversation and film screening of Escalation, a film that highlights the earliest warning signs of relationship violence. The YWCA Greenwich, in partnership with the One Love Foundation, is presenting the film.

According to a release from the YWCA, the statistics are staggering: 1 in 3 women and 1 in 4 men will be in a violent relationship in their lifetime.

Nearly 50 percent of these women and 40 percent of these men experience relationship violence for the first time between ages 18 and 24.
